Worst of the weather 'has passed'

Two flood warnings issued by the Environment Agency (EA) in West Yorkshire remain in place.

The warnings are for the A656 and properties near to the River Aire at Allerton Ings near Leeds.

But the EA said it believed the worst of the weekend's weather had passed for West Yorkshire.

A less-severe flood watch is in place for the River Calder from Brighouse to Castleford. The EA's 24-hour Floodline is 0845 988 1188.
